Question What is a cigalike?
-
Answer
A cigalike is an electronic cigarette built to the shape and size of a real cigarette - roughly 85mm long and the same diameter, usually with a white body and a coloured tip. It is the oldest form factor in vaping and still the most familiar to anyone coming from tobacco.
Instead of burning anything, a cigalike heats e-liquid into vapour. There is no flame, no ash and no smoke. Our SNAPS® REV5 is a rechargeable cigalike, so you replace the cartridge rather than the whole device.
-
Question How does a cigalike work?
-
Answer
Two parts. The battery forms the body of the cigarette. The cartridge screws or clips onto the end and contains both the e-liquid and the heating coil.
Draw on it and the battery powers the coil, which turns a small amount of e-liquid into vapour. When a cartridge runs out you fit a fresh one - no cleaning, no refilling and no coil changes. Question What is e-liquid?
-
Answer
E-liquid, also called vape juice or e-juice, is what a vape device heats to produce vapour. Nothing burns - the liquid is warmed until it turns to vapour, which is why there is no smoke, ash or combustion.
Every e-liquid is built from a base of propylene glycol and vegetable glycerin, plus flavouring, and nicotine where the strength calls for it. Nicotine-free options are available across our range.

Question What nicotine strengths are available in the UK?
-
Answer
UK law caps nicotine at 20mg/ml and limits nicotine-containing e-liquid to 10ml bottles. Our range covers four strengths:
- 0mg/ml - nicotine-free
- 6mg/ml - light
- 12mg/ml (1.2%) - moderate
- 20mg/ml (2.0%) - the UK maximum
Any strength above 20mg/ml cannot legally be sold in the UK, whatever you may see quoted from other markets. Most people find it easier to start lower and step up than the other way round.
Nicotine is an addictive substance. Our products are intended for adults aged 18 and over who already smoke or vape.
mg/ml and percentage are the same measure. Divide by ten to convert: 6mg/ml is 0.6%, 12mg/ml is 1.2%, and 20mg/ml is 2.0%. UK bottles are usually labelled in mg/ml, while some other markets and older packaging use the percentage.
A cigarette is not directly comparable - the nicotine actually absorbed depends on how it is smoked, and the same is true of vaping. Rather than converting from cigarettes, most people find it more useful to start at a strength and adjust by how satisfied they feel after a few days.
-
Question What are PG and VG, and what is the difference?
-
Answer
Propylene glycol (PG) is a thin, colourless, odourless liquid. It carries flavour well and produces most of the throat hit.
Vegetable glycerin (VG) is thicker and slightly sweet, derived from vegetable oil. It produces denser vapour and a smoother inhale.
Every e-liquid is a blend of the two, and the ratio shapes how it vapes: higher PG for throat hit and flavour definition, higher VG for vapour volume and smoothness. Common ratios are 50:50, 60:40 and 70:30. Our blends are pre-mixed and balanced for their intended device, so there is nothing for you to calculate. A small number of people find PG irritating - a higher-VG blend is the answer if that applies to you.

Question What is the difference between nic salt and freebase?
-
Answer
Freebase nicotine gives a sharper throat hit and carries flavour assertively. It suits refillable tanks, e-pipes and higher-power devices.
Nicotine salts deliver nicotine more quickly with a noticeably smoother throat hit at the same strength, which is why they suit compact pod systems and cigalikes where you take shorter, more frequent draws.

Question How should I store e-liquid, and how long does it keep?
-
Answer
Every bottle carries a printed batch number and expiry date, and stored properly e-liquid keeps well within that date.
Keep bottles away from heat and direct light, upright, with the cap closed. Heat and UV are what degrade flavour and base over time - a bottle left on a sunny windowsill will turn long before one in a drawer. E-liquid does not evaporate through a closed cap, but it will darken with age, which is normal oxidation rather than spoilage.
If a liquid has darkened considerably, separated, or smells noticeably different from when you opened it, replace it. Store out of reach of children and animals - our bottles have child-resistant caps with a raised triangle for blind and partially sighted users, under a tamper-evident seal.
-
Question Can I mix different e-liquids together?
-
Answer
You can, and plenty of people do. Mixing two finished e-liquids of the same nicotine strength is straightforward - the result is a blend of both flavours, and it may or may not taste good. Tobacco and menthol mix well; tobacco and fruit usually do not.
Mixing across manufacturers can give unpredictable results, since base ratios and flavour concentrations differ. Try a small quantity before committing a full bottle. Note that mixing two strengths averages the nicotine, so keep track if that matters to you.
We do not sell nicotine concentrates or base for home mixing, and we would not recommend handling undiluted nicotine.
-
Question Why does my vape taste burnt?
-
Answer
Almost always a dry wick. The coil is heating with too little liquid reaching it, so what burns is the wick rather than the e-liquid.
Common causes: the tank or pod has run low; a new coil was fired before the wick had time to saturate, so prime it and wait a minute or two; drawing repeatedly without a pause between puffs; or a high-VG liquid in a device designed for something thinner. If the taste persists after refilling and resting the device, the coil has gone and needs replacing.

Question What is a vape pipe?
-
Answer
A vape pipe - also called an e-pipe or electronic pipe - is a pipe-shaped vape. It keeps the shape, weight and slow draw of a traditional briar / rosewood pipe, but instead of burning tobacco it heats e-liquid into vapour. There is no flame, no ash, no ember and nothing to relight.
The appeal for most of our customers is the ritual rather than the nicotine: the weight of the bowl in the hand, the unhurried draw, and being able to keep that habit indoors and in places where lighting a pipe is not an option.

Question What is a vaporizer?
-
Answer
A vaporizer heats e-liquid or dry botanical material to produce vapour, without burning it. All e-cigarettes are vaporizers, but not all vaporizers are e-cigarettes - the differences are in form factor and use.
- Cigalikes - shaped and sized like a real cigarette, with replaceable cartridges
- E-cigars and e-pipes - larger classic formats built for the ritual and the feel of the original
- Vape pods and pod mods - compact, refillable, longer battery life
- Dry herb vaporizers - heat loose dried botanical material rather than e-liquid. Use only with legal botanicals, in line with UK law

Question What are Liquamizers, clearomizers and vape tanks?
-
Answer
All three are containers that hold e-liquid. A clearomizer is a transparent plastic or glass tank with a built-in atomizer - wicks draw liquid onto the heating coil, which produces the vapour.
Liquamizer is our own term, used mainly for our electronic pipes. It is a glass tank designed for the 629 series, taking replaceable atomizer coils.
-
Question What are cigalikes, cartridges and cartomizers?
-
Answer
A cigalike is an e-cigarette built to the shape and size of a traditional cigarette. On rechargeable models the battery is reused and the cartridge holding the e-liquid is replaced.
Early cartridges were bulky three-part assemblies: a container, a separate heating element, and a cotton sponge soaked in e-liquid. We introduced the SNAPS® all-in-one cartridge, or cartomizer - prefilled, with the coil and cotton built in, connecting to the battery magnetically rather than by screw thread. When it is finished you fit a fresh one. A great many modern pod systems work on the same principle.

Question Are vaporizers regulated in the UK?
-
Answer
Yes, closely. All ePuffer products sold in the UK comply with the Tobacco and Related Products Regulations (TRPR): nicotine strength capped at 20mg/ml, nicotine-containing e-liquid in 10ml bottles, 2ml maximum tank and pod capacity, and compliant labelling and packaging. Nicotine-containing products are notified to the MHRA as required.
Our e-liquids are diacetyl-free. Ingredients are listed on each product page.
Nicotine is an addictive substance. Our products are intended for adults aged 18 and over who already smoke or vape, and are not suitable for non-smokers, under-18s, or anyone pregnant or breastfeeding.
